The myrmecophilous Paederinae rove beetle genus Megastilicus Casey, 1889 from North America is reviewed based on museum specimens. Prior to this study, the genus was monotypic with one species Megastilicus formicarius Casey, 1889 described. Here, we provide a redescription of the genus and the type species, designate a lectotype, and provide pictures of habitus and illustrations of the aedeagus and genital segments. Additionally, we describe a new species for the genus, Megastilicus iowaensis sp. nov., include an identification key to the two species and present the distribution map of both of them, including new state records. We discuss the assignment of the genus to the subtribe Stilicina based on morphological features.
Selizitapia gen. nov. (Hemiptera: Fulgoromorpha: Flatidae) from tapia woodlands of Madagascar
(2021)
A new monotypic genus of flatid planthoppers (Hemiptera: Fulgoromorpha: Flatidae), Selizitapia gen. nov., is described for Selizitapia pennyi gen. et sp. nov. (type species) from the island of Madagascar. Habitus, male and female external and internal genital structures of the new species are illustrated and compared with similar taxa. Selizitapia pennyi gen. et sp. nov. is endemic to Madagascar where it is known to date only from one locality in the Central Plateau and is associated with tapia woodland formation.
A new monotypic genus of flatid planthoppers (Hemiptera: Fulgoromorpha: Flatidae), Medleria gen. nov., is described for Medleria caudata gen. et sp. nov. (type species) from the island of Socotra (Yemen). Habitus, male and female external and internal genital structures of the new species are illustrated and compared with similar taxa. Medleria caudata gen. et sp. nov. is probably endemic to Socotra where it is known to date from a small area of the Dixam mountain plateau only.
Bujurquina is the most widely distributed and species-rich genus of cichlids in the western Amazon of South America. In this study we describe a new species from Peru from a hypothesized reverse flowing river system. Prior to the origin of the modern Amazon River at 4.5 Ma, this river system had its headwaters on the Iquitos arch, one of several main structural arches (swells) in the Amazon. Prior to the origin of the modern Amazon these arches formed topographic barriers of drainage basins in lowland Amazonia. For our analyses we use morphological and molecular data, analyzed through multivariate statistics and molecular phylogenies, respectivelly. For all valid species in the genus (except B. cordemadi and B. pardus) we additionally for the first time provide photographs of live specimens. Based on DNA phylogeny and coloration patterns we demonstrate that Bujurquina is divided into two main clades and based on this we provide a dichotomous key for all the species.
Three subterranean leptodirine leiodid taxa, viz., Bozidaria Ćurčić & Pavićević gen. nov., Bozidaria serbooccidentalis Ćurčić & Pavićević gen. et sp. nov. and Proleonhardella (Proleonhardella) tarensis Ćurčić & Pavićević sp. nov., are described and diagnosed. Bozidaria Ćurčić & Pavićević gen. nov. belongs to the phyletic series of “Leonhardella”. The new beetle taxa differ from their closest relatives in numerous morphological characters. They most likely belong to phyletic lineages of Pliocene age. The new leiodid taxa are endemic to the Dinaric mountain chain of western Serbia. Keys to the leptodirine leiodid genera of the phyletic series of “Leonhardella” and to the taxa of the genus Proleonhardella Jeannel, 1910 are included.
Plagiognathus ozgurkocaki sp. nov. is described based on a long series of specimens from Karaman, Turkey. The new species is remarkable among its congeners in Palearctic Region due to the combination of following characters: remarkably small size, dense and unicolorous pale yellow vestiture, darkened cuneus and yellow first antennal segment with a basal ring and pre-apical dots. The new species is associated with the endemic Phlomis leucophracta P.H.Davis & Hub.-Mor. (Lamiaceae) which makes it unique among all its congeners. Additionally, Plagiognathus bipunctatus albicans (Reuter, 1901) and Plagiognathus marivanensis Linnavuori, 2010 are recorded from Karaman, former constitutes a new record for Turkey.
Review of Synapsis Bates (Scarabaeidae: Scarabaeinae: Coprini), with description of a new species
(2010)
Presented are a checklist, a discussion of and keys to species groups and their constituent species, and a description of one new species: Synapsis horaki. The species Synapsis cambeforti Krikken and S. thoas Sharp are synonymized with S. ritsemae Lansberge, Balthasar’s synonymy of S. yunnana Arrow with S. tridens Sharp is revived, and the status of six recently described species is left unresolved because of insufficient data.
The spider genus Zaitunia Lehtinen, 1967 (Araneae, Filistatidae) is revised. It was found to include 24 species distributed in the Eastern Mediterranean, Middle East and Central Asia: ♀ Z. afghana (Roewer, 1962) (Afghanistan), ♀ Z. alexandri Brignoli, 1982 (Iran), ♀ Z. akhanii Marusik & Zamani, 2015 (Iran), ♂♀ Z. annulipes (Kulczyński, 1908) (Cyprus), ♂♀ Z. beshkentica (Andreeva & Tyshchenko, 1969) (Tajikistan, Uzbekistan), ♀ Z. brignoliana sp. nov. (Iran), ♂♀ Z. ferghanensis sp. nov. (Kyrgyzstan, Uzbekistan), ♀ Z. feti sp. nov. (Turkmenistan), ♀ Z. halepensis sp. nov. (Syria), ♀ Z. huberi sp. nov. (Afghanistan), ♀ Z. inderensis Ponomarev, 2005 (Kazakhstan), ♂♀ Z. kunti sp. nov. (Cyprus, Turkey), ♂♀ Z. logunovi sp. nov. (Kazakhstan, Kyrgyzstan), ♂♀ Z. maracandica (Charitonov, 1946) (Uzbekistan, Kazakhstan), ♂♀ Z. martynovae (Andreeva & Tyshchenko, 1969) (Tajikistan, Turkmenistan), ♀ Z. medica Brignoli, 1982 (Iran), ♂♀ Z. minoica sp. nov. (Greece), ♀ Z. minuta sp. nov. (Uzbekistan), ♀ Z. persica Brignoli, 1982 (Iran), ♂ Z. psammodroma sp. nov. (Turkmenistan), ♂♀ Z. schmitzi (Kulczyński, 1911), the type species (Egypt, Israel), ♂♀ Z. spinimana sp. nov. (Kazakhstan, Turkmenistan), ♂♀ Z. wunderlichi sp. nov. (Kyrgyzstan) and ♀ Z. zonsteini Fomichev & Marusik, 1969 (Kazakhstan). Twelve above-listed species are newly described, and males of Z. annulipes, Z. beshkentica, Z. maracandica and Z. martynovae are described for the first time. Two new combinations are established: Z. annulipes (Kulczyński, 1908) comb. nov., ex Filistata, and Pholcoides monticola (Spassky, 1941) comb. nov., ex Zaitunia. New data on distribution of the considered taxa are provided.
The genus Raveniola Zonstein, 1987 is found to be represented in Western Asia by 16 species: ♂♀ R. adjarica sp. nov. (Georgia), ♂ R. anadolu sp. nov. (Turkey), ♂ R. arthuri Kunt & Yağmur, 2010 (Turkey), ♂ R. birecikensis sp. nov. (Turkey), ♂♀ R. dunini sp. nov. (Armenia, Azerbaijan, Iran), ♂♀ R. hyrcanica Dunin, 1988 (Azerbaijan), ♂ R. marusiki sp. nov. (Iran), ♂ R. mazandaranica Marusik, Zamani & Mirshamsi, 2014 (Iran), ♂♀ R. micropa (Ausserer, 1871) (Turkey), ♀ R. nana sp. nov. (Turkey), ♂♀ R. niedermeyeri (Brignoli, 1972) (Iran), ♂♀ R. pontica (Spassky, 1937) (Russia, Georgia), ♀ R. sinani sp. nov. (Turkey), ♂♀ R. turcica sp. nov. (Turkey), ♂♀ R. vonwicki Zonstein, 2000 (Iran) and ♂♀ R. zaitzevi (Charitonov, 1948) (Azerbaijan, Georgia) = ♀ Brachythele recki Mcheidze, 1983, syn. nov. Eight species are described as new; others are redescribed from types and/or conspecific material. Males of R. micropa and R. zaitzevi, hitherto unknown, are described for the first time. Data on the variability, relationships, distribution and ecology of all considered species are also provided.
